The Science Behind the Softness
What makes baby urine pads so effective isn’t just their absorbency — it’s the thoughtful design that combines comfort, functionality, and safety. The top layer is made from a soft, breathable fabric that feels gentle on a baby’s sensitive skin. Underneath, high-absorbency polymers quickly lock away moisture, preventing discomfort and reducing the risk of rashes.
Thoughtful features like leak-proof edges and hypoallergenic materials make these pads ideal for even the most sensitive little ones. Whether it’s a full bladder or a sudden splash, the design ensures that the mess stays where it is — on the pad, not on your mattress.

Choosing the Right Fit: Disposable or Reusable?
When it comes to baby urine pads, there’s no one-size-fits-all answer. Some parents prefer the convenience of disposable pads, which can be tossed away after use. Others opt for washable versions that are eco-friendly and cost-effective in the long run.
Disposable pads are ideal for travel, emergencies, or busy days when laundry is the last thing on your mind. Reusable pads, on the other hand, can be a sustainable option for families looking to reduce waste. Both types offer excellent leak protection — it’s all about finding what works best for your lifestyle.
